Tampering with Tradition

How come some people try so hard to have fighting banned from the sport of hockey? In a society where violence has become an every day occurrence, why focus on a sport that has involved fighting for nearly a century? Most do not understand the respect opponents have for each other. There are different reasons two players will drop the gloves in a game, but hardly ever with the intention to hurt one another. Hockey, like most sports, is a traditional game that has evolved but not changed. Fighting is a part of hockey that has always been accepted and should continue to be accepted for the existence of the sport.

Tradition is a very important factor in many sports. Any athlete who is competitive in a sport will tell you never to alter tradition. In a game of hockey, you can usually bet on seeing a fight as a thrilling tradition. For some players, entire hockey careers can depend on being the enforcer of a team. On a team, there are the goal scorers, the defensive players, the goaltenders, and then we have the scrappers. If fighting were to ever become extinct in hockey, there would be no place for the scrappers.
